Transaction deb327cdd9d2403b9626fdfa7c42a6e8a941343583ce22e2254f43009371177a
1 Input
1 Output
-
deb327cdd9d2403b9626fdfa7c42a6e8a941343583ce22e2254f43009371177a:0
- value
- 153140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d79f83f42c9ad8e39999b6960c7ab1d4a7ae4e3e OP_EQUAL
- address
- 3MM8J7c49bq73UQZsk1p2quSHw92jstmbm